Nestled within the sparsely populated, forested hills of the Ozarks, in Miller County, Arkansas, southeast of Texarkana, lies a legend that has captivated imaginations for generations: the Boggy Creek Monster. This enigmatic creature, also known as the Fouke Monster, has been a local legend since the 1840s, weaving its way into the folklore and cultural fabric of the region.

The Boggy Creek Monster is often described as a Bigfoot-like entity, standing approximately seven feet tall with an imposing presence. It is said to possess an upright gait, covered in thick, shaggy hair, and emanating a pungent, animalistic odor that precedes its arrival. As the Arkansas counterpart to the legendary Sasquatch or Bigfoot, this hairy beast has garnered a reputation for its alleged nocturnal activities, which include preying on chickens, livestock, and even dogs. However, despite its fearsome appearance and reported predatory behavior, there have been no documented cases of the Boggy Creek Monster directly harming humans.

A History Shrouded in Mystery

The legend of the Boggy Creek Monster gained significant traction in the late 1860s when it was reported that two families living on the outskirts of Fouke were harassed by the creature. These early encounters fueled the local lore and contributed to the monster’s growing notoriety. The tales of the beast quickly spread throughout the region, solidifying its place in the collective consciousness of the community.

The legend experienced a resurgence in popularity in 1973 with the release of the low-budget film, "The Legend of Boggy Creek." Despite its modest production value, the movie struck a chord with audiences, further amplifying the monster’s fame and drawing attention to the town of Fouke.

Renewed Sightings and Continued Interest

The allure of the Boggy Creek Monster persisted throughout the years, with numerous reported sightings adding fuel to the legend. In 1997, there were more than 40 reported sightings of the creature, sparking renewed interest in the phenomenon. The following year, in 1998, reports surfaced of the hairy beast being spotted walking along a dry creek bed approximately five miles south of Fouke. These more recent sightings served as a reminder that the legend of the Boggy Creek Monster remained alive and well in the hearts and minds of the local population.

Fouke: Embracing the Legend

The town of Fouke, recognizing the economic potential of the Boggy Creek Monster legend, embraced its unique identity and capitalized on its connection to the mysterious creature. Signs adorned the town, welcoming visitors to the realm of the Fouke Monster, and a gift shop near Boggy Creek emerged, offering an array of Monster-themed souvenirs. This commercialization of the legend helped to draw tourists to the area, boosting the local economy and solidifying Fouke’s reputation as the home of the Boggy Creek Monster.

Today, Monster Mart continues to cater to tourists, offering a wide selection of souvenirs, from T-shirts and hats to figurines and postcards, all emblazoned with the image of the legendary beast.

Searching for Boggy Creek

For those seeking to experience the legend firsthand, a visit to Boggy Creek itself is a must. However, finding the elusive creek can be a challenge, as it is not prominently marked. After a thorough search, visitors can locate the creek south of Fouke, identified by a small plaque on the bridge that spans its waters. The Confluence of Rivers

According to local lore, the Boggy Creek Monster was last seen near the junction of the Sulphur and Red Rivers. This confluence of waterways serves as a fitting backdrop for the legend, as the murky depths and dense vegetation provide ample cover for the elusive creature.
